Description

We've kept our 2026 GDP forecast unchanged at 3.8%, following the just-confirmed 3.6% expansion last year. The near-full set of Q4 data indicates that the economy has maintained its strong momentum, likely carrying this over into 2026. We consider risks to be skewed to stronger growth, with GDP expansion at 4% this year not off the table.
